Nicole’s Guilt Trip: When Ice Queens Start Melting
Nicole Dupree Richardson has been serving Ted nothing but arctic coldness ever since the explosive revelation that he fathered Eva (Ambyr Michelle) during a decades-old affair with the unhinged Leslie Thomas. The usually composed psychiatrist has been wielding her divorce papers like a weapon, determined to end their marriage once and for all.
Recent episodes have shown Nicole struggling with her family’s unanimous betting against Ted when he tried to prove he could help by blocking Leslie from moving across from the Duprees. Even Vernon (Clifton Davis) and Anita (Tamara Tunie) joined the pile-on, leaving Ted completely isolated and furious.
Now Nicole is having serious second thoughts about her scorched-earth approach. Sources reveal she’ll be wrestling with whether she’s been too harsh on her cheating husband. But here’s the kicker – just as Nicole starts softening, Ted is about to face an “unwelcome reality check” that could send him spiraling. Could this be Leslie making her next devastating move?

Teen Terror: When the Kids Revolt
Martin Richardson and Smitty have been living their picture-perfect life with adopted teenagers Tyrell and Samantha. But beneath the surface, tensions have been brewing over Smitty’s desire to return to investigative journalism just as Martin eyes a presidential run.
Recent episodes revealed that Tyrell has been acting distant and his grades are slipping – specifically that calculus test that didn’t meet the family’s high standards. Meanwhile, Samantha has been caught kissing boys and challenging her dads’ authority with typical teenage sass.
The sibling clash that erupts on Tuesday will be so explosive that both Martin and Smitty will be left scrambling to deal with the fallout. When your typically well-behaved kids start going off the rails, it usually means deeper family issues are bubbling to the surface.
